Child Protection Cases

Child Protective Services

You are here: Home / Practice Areas / Family Law / Child Protection Cases

Child Protective Services, or CPS for short, is a State agency set up by law to ensure the health and safety of children. Any unsafe activity should be reported immediately by calling 1-800-252-5400.

The purpose of any involvement by CPS is to keep children safe. CPS is by no means a punishment for parents. Judges in Texas have broad discretion to act when a child’s health or safety is involved. If a court proceeding is involved with your CPS case, you have the right to an attorney.

Before taking an action in a CPS case or court, you should seek representation. Your attorney can explain to you the order of the proceedings, your rights and remedies under Texas law, and should be able to advise you as to how best to proceed.
